Practice Description
Ms. Milczynski's practice encompasses pension and benefits, employment and administrative law. She has advised and represented corporate plan sponsors, plan administrators, accounting firms and unions on all matters related to the establishment and administration of pension plans. She also provides advice with respect to plan wind-up, and the pension issues that arise on the purchase and sale of a business. |
